Transaction 41afc81cd49f1af1fcb430b42836d77c832bb979dfb23d03f96a2fe73f1ec275

1 Input
2 Outputs
  • 41afc81cd49f1af1fcb430b42836d77c832bb979dfb23d03f96a2fe73f1ec275:0
  • value  17290883
    address  3NwBbd3a36XA7Z4TzV3Zk26BzsGo2eM5yM
  • 41afc81cd49f1af1fcb430b42836d77c832bb979dfb23d03f96a2fe73f1ec275:1
  • value  5000000
    address  149XPT1WM5qiy1zqwBjVe7NiiYZdKh3ZdF